Welcome back to the Communications Business Advisor™ podcast with host Tara McDonagh. In this episode, Tara explores what happens when you're not in the right room — and how the right room can completely change your thinking, decisions, and authority.
Building on recent conversations about isolation and helpfulness, this episode focuses on a key shift: strong leadership isn't built in isolation. It's built in dialogue.
Tara shares how even experienced communicators can miss critical angles when thinking alone — not because they lack skill, but because of natural blind spots. The right conversation, with the right person, can change everything.
This episode reframes "finding your people" as something much more than support. It's a leadership strategy that directly impacts how you think, advise, and show up in your role.
